Publications by Tinniam V Ganesh

yorkr pads up for the Twenty20s: Part 1- Analyzing team”s match performance

16.04.2016

There are two ways of constructing a software design: One way is to make it so simple that there are obviously no deficiencies and the other way is to make it so complicated that there are no obvious deficiencies. C.A.R. Hoare, The 1980 ACM Turing Award Lecture One of my most productive days was throwing away 1000 lines of code. Ken T...

7008 sym R (9609 sym/33 pcs) 58 img

yorkr pads up for Twenty20s:Part 4- Individual batting and bowling performances!

17.04.2016

Introduction In theory, theory and practice are the same. In practice, they’re not. Yogi Berra There are two ways to write error-free programs; only the third one works. Alan Perlis Simplicity does not precede complexity, but follows it. Alan Perlis Talk is cheap. Show me the cod...

7721 sym R (10265 sym/52 pcs) 130 img

yorkr crashes the IPL party! – Part 4

22.04.2016

Introduction I’ve missed more than 9000 shots in my career. I’ve lost almost 300 games. 26 times, I’ve been trusted to take the game winning shot and missed. I’ve failed over and over and over again in my life. And that is why I succeed. Michael Jordan Success is where preparation and opportunity meet. ...

8027 sym R (10024 sym/52 pcs) 130 img

yorkr ranks IPL batsmen and bowlers

25.04.2016

Here is a short post which ranks IPL batsmen and bowlers. These are based on match data from Cricsheet. Ranking batsmen and bowlers in IPL is more challenging as the players can belong to different teams in different years. Hence I create a combined data frame of the batsmen and bowlers regardless of their IPL teams and calculate a) average runs ...

2469 sym R (3436 sym/3 pcs) 4 img

yorkr ranks T20 batsmen and bowlers

26.04.2016

Here is another short post which ranks T20 batsmen and bowlers. These are based on match data from Cricsheet. The ranking is done on average runs and average strike rate for batsmen and average wickets and average economy rate for bowlers. This post has also been published in RPubs RankT20Players. You can download this as a pdf file at RankT20P...

1905 sym R (3341 sym/3 pcs) 4 img

yorkr ranks ODI batsmen and bowlers

28.04.2016

This is the last and final post in which yorkr ranks ODI batsmen and bowlers. These are based on match data from Cricsheet. The ranking is done on average runs and average strike rate for batsmen and average wickets and average economy rate for bowlers. This post has also been published in RPubs RankODIPlayers. You can download this as a pdf fi...

1585 sym R (3497 sym/3 pcs) 4 img

Beaten by sheer pace – Cricket analytics with yorkr

08.05.2016

My ebook “Beaten by sheer pace – Cricket analytics with yorkr’  has been published in Leanpub.  You can now download the book (hot off the press!)  for all formats to your favorite device (mobile, iPad, tablet, Kindle)  from the Leanpub  “Beaten by sheer pace!”. The book has been published in the following formats namely PDF (for ...

1426 sym 8 img

Beaten by sheer pace! Cricket analytics with yorkr in paperback and Kindle versions

10.05.2016

My book “Beaten by sheer pace! Cricket analytics with yorkr” is now available in paperback and Kindle versions. The paperback is available from Amazon (US, UK and Europe) for $ 54.95. The Kindle version can be downloaded from the Kindle store for $4.99 (Rs 332/-). Do pick up your copy. It should be a good read for a Sunday afternoon. This boo...

2456 sym 6 img

Re-introducing cricketr! : An R package to analyze performances of cricketers

14.05.2016

In this post I re-introduce R package cricketr. I have added 8 new functions to my R package cricketr, available from version cricketr_0.0.13 namely batsmanCumulativeAverageRuns batsmanCumulativeStrikeRate bowlerCumulativeAvgEconRate bowlerCumulativeAvgWicketRate relativeBatsmanCumulativeAvgRuns relativeBatsmanCumulativeStrikeRate relativeBowler...

22910 sym R (14849 sym/68 pcs) 102 img

Exploring Quantum Gate operations with QCSimulator

05.06.2016

Introduction: Ever since I was initiated into Quantum Computing, through IBM’s Quantum Experience I have been hooked. My initial encounter with domain made me very excited and all wound up. The reason behind this, I think, is because there is an air of mystery around ‘Quantum’ anything.  After my early rush with the Quantum Experience, I h...

4737 sym R (2989 sym/8 pcs) 40 img